Phil Cousineau is an award-winning writer and filmmaker, story consultant and editor, travel leader, and inspirational speaker on myth in the modern world. He even studied and collaborated with the great Joesph Campbell.

In this mind meld, we riff on the enduring power of myth, what it's like to work with Joseph Campbell, the impact of sacred travel, how to practically apply myth in our own lives and minds, and much more!
